GS reportedly had Curry #2 overall in the draft. They just didn't think he'd fall to #6 so they made other plans.

They had a provisional deal with Phoenix on the assumption that Curry wouldn't be there at #6 - so Curry was never close to going to Phoenix as the Warriors were only trading the pick if Curry wasn't there. Curry dropping to #6 was the reason the deal was called off.

Similarly, he was never close to going to New York either.
